Easy White Chicken Chili: Creamy Comfort in Every Spoonful

Bowl of white chicken chili topped with cilantro and lime wedges

This white chicken chili is a soul-warming bowl of tender chicken, creamy white beans, and mild green chiles—perfect for chilly evenings and casual weeknight dinners.

Ingredients for White Chicken Chili

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1.5 pounds boneless skinless chicken breasts, cut into chunks
  • 2 (15-ounce) cans cannellini be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 (4-ounce) can diced green chiles
  • 4 cups chicken broth
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• ½ teaspoon ground cumin
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• Optional toppings: sour cream, shredded cheese, chopped cilantro, lime wedges

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Heat the olive oil in a Dutch oven over medium heat.
  2. Add the chicken chunks, diced onion, and minced garlic. Cook until the chicken is lightly browned and the onion is translucent, about 5 minutes.
  3. Sprinkle in the oregano and cumin; stir well to coat the chicken and onions with spices.
  4. Pour in the chicken broth, then stir in the cannellini beans and diced green chiles.
  5.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er. Reduce heat to low, cover, and cook for 20 minutes.
  6. Uncover and simmer an additional 10 minutes to thicken slightly. Season with salt and pepper.
  7. Ladle into bowls and garnish with sour cream, shredded cheese, cilantro, and a squeeze of lime.

Tips & Variations

  • Extra heat: Add chopped jalapeños or a dash of cayenne.
  • Richer broth: Stir in ¼ cup half-and-half or cream.
  • Slow cooker option: Brown chicken and aromatics, then transfer all ingredients to a crockpot. Cook on low for 4 hours.
  • Vegetarian tweak: Omit chicken and boost beans, adding kidney or great northern beans.

Nutrition Facts (per serving)

  • Calories: 466 kcal
  • Carbohydrates: 53 g
  • Protein: 35 g
  • Fat: 12 g (Saturated Fat 4 g)
  • Fiber: 14 g
  • Sodium: 2726 mg
  • Sugar: 5 g
